Job Description
Field Asset Registration Technician
Adepto Technical Recruitment Limited
- Travel to customer locations to carry out machine tagging and registration activities - Apply QR code labels to machines and equipment - Use a mobile phone or handheld device to register assets into an online system - Accurately capture and upload required machine information - Ensure all records are completed correctly and consistently - Represent the company professionally while on customer premises - Communicate clearly and politely with customer contacts on-site - Follow site procedures and health & safety requirements - Report progress and completed work to the project manager/team
Job Requirements
- .Strong attention to detail and accuracy
- .Good interpersonal and communication skills
- .Professional and well-presented manner
- .Comfortable using smartphones, apps, and web-based systems
- . Ability to work independently and manage travel schedules efficiently
- .Good organisational and time management skills
- .Full UK driving licence required
- .Previous field-based, customer service, installation, surveying, or data collection experience would be advantageous
Benefits
- Company vehicle or mileage reimbursement provided, depending on arrangement
